高性能双软管隔膜泵曲轴可靠性设计

Abstract
Aiming at the localization of high-performance double hose diaphragm pump,we design the structural reliability of the core component crankshaft.Through the kinematic analysis of the crankshaft,and on the basis of the dynamic load during operation,the maximum stress and deformation of the crankshaft are further studied,and the fatigue strength of the dangerous section of the crankshaft is checked.Finally,the vibration frequency and mode shape of the crankshaft are obtained through modal analysis.The results show that the strength and stiffness of the crankshaft structure are safe and reliable,the fatigue safety factor of the dangerous section is 3.2,the vibration frequency is higher than the working frequency,and the crankshaft structure design meets the requirements.The research results provide guidance for the localization and popularization of high-performance double hose diaphragm pump with good effect.关键词
